EncXosed for your information is a copy of city o~ Seward
Resolution Nor ~8-015, urging the state to continue ful! fund-
'Lng of the Trail Lakes Fish Hatchery. This resolution was
approved by the Seward City Council at its regular meeting of
February 8, 1988.
The City Council would appreciate your support in its endeavor
to assure the continued operation of the Trail Lakes Hatchery
aa a part o£ the Resurrection Bay and Prince William Sound
£isheries enhancement program.

Sponsored by: Neehan
CITY OF SEWARD, ALASKA-
RESOLUTION NO. 88-015
A RESOLUTION O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F
SEWARD, ALASKA, URGING FULL F~NDING OF THE
TRAIL LAKES FISH HATCHERY
WHEREAS, the Trail Lakes Fish Hatchery was constructed
by the state of Alaska to enhance the salmon fishery for the
.Kenai Peninsula and Prince William Sound; and
WHEREAS, Trail Lakes Hatchery ia currently the breeding
ground for all hatchery produced silver salmon which return
to Resurrection Bay; and
WHEREAS, the sport salmon fishery in Seward is
dependent upon Trail Lakes Hatchery for its continued
success; and
WHEREAS, Trail Lakes Hatchery would be the logical
facility to enhance the sockeye population in Bear Lake; and
WHEREAS, the Crooked Creek Hatchery currently obtains
its fingerlings from the Trail Lakes Hatchery for its smelt
production; and
WHEREAS, the Department of Fish and Game has proposed
to eliminate the Trail Lakes Hatchery program from its FY
1989 budget and transfer management and operation of the
£acility to Cook Inlet Aquaculture Association; and
WHEREAS, CIAA has given no assurances that it will
continue to provide fisherios enhancement services to the
Kenai Peninsula, and it is possible that its resources will
be diverted to the Cook Inlet;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F
THE CITY OF SEWARD, ALASKA, that:
section 1. The AlaSka Department of Fish and Game is
urged'"to""iully fund the $350,000 annual operating budget for
the Trail Lakes Fish Hatchery in order to assure continued
support of the sport fishery in Resurrection Bay and the
rest of the Kenai Peninsula and the commercial fishery in
Prince William Sound.
